Introducing the new FUSE SOA Suite Based on Apache ActiveMQ (JMS) High performance, reliable messaging with many options for deployment & client connectivity FUSE Message Broker Based on Apache ServiceMix (JBI) Agile integration with open APIs for mediating engines as well as transports and protocols FUSE ESB Based on Apache CXF (JAX-WS) Lightweight, pluggable, extensible services framework and service enablement FUSE Services Framework Based on Apache Camel Easily defined process routing based on standard Enterprise Integration Patterns definitions FUSE Mediation Router

IONA Open Source Leadership IONA currently funds leaders and committers on several key projects: Apache CXF (Services Framework) Eclipse SOA Tools Project (Services Tooling) Apache Yoko (CORBA) Apache Tuscany (SCA) Apache WSS4J LogicBlaze adds established leaders and committers: Apache ActiveMQ Apache ServiceMix Apache Camel Apache ODE More…

IONA’s Open Source FUSE Product Line “Fuses” the best of LogicBlaze and IONA open source Expands IONA open source project and community expertise Expands IONA’s consulting, support and training offerings Maintains core functionality which eases existing customer migrations “Component-based” rather than “stack based” Flexible for adaptable, extensible configuration Components can be used stand-alone, or in combination Components are tightly aligned with key Apache projects Introduces a new product based on Apache Camel Solution for simple, POJO-based routing and mediation Leverages Enterprise Integration Patterns definitions Transport-neutral for portability

IONA Open Source SOA Suite Based on Apache ActiveMQ (JMS) High performance, reliable messaging with many options for deployment & client connectivity Deploy Configure Monitor Control SOA Tooling SOA Backplane Components FUSE Message Broker Based on Apache ServiceMix (JBI) Agile integration with open APIs for mediating engines as well as transports and protocols FUSE ESB Based on Apache CXF (JAX-WS) Lightweight, pluggable, extensible services framework and service enablement FUSE Services Framework Based on Apache Camel Easily defined process routing based on standard Enterprise Integration Patterns definitions FUSE Mediation Router
